Re: [RC] shavings vs rice hulls - RDCARRIE

We tried the rice hulls.  They were nice for sifting out the poop without getting a lot of the bedding (hulls).  However, they were practically non-absorbant.  So the "pee spots" remained as little lakes of pee under the layer of rice hulls, rather than the pee being soaked up by shavings.  We've gone back to shavings for that reason.  We only stall 2 horses at night, our 31 yr old so that he has all night to munch on his dinner, and a buddy horse for him.
